Understanding the different types of caravans can help buyers make informed decisions when purchasing or sourcing caravans for resale. Here are some common types of caravans:
Touring Caravans
These caravans are designed for mobility and travel. They are equipped with essential amenities like sleeping areas, kitchens, and bathrooms. They come in various sizes, accommodating different numbers of people. Their lightweight construction makes them easier to tow with vehicles.
Static Caravans
Unlike touring caravans, these are not meant to be moved around frequently. They are used as temporary or permanent residences in holiday parks or residential sites. They offer home-like comforts with fixed installations, including multiple bedrooms, living rooms, and kitchens.
Camper Trailers
These are modified trailers that incorporate a tent for camping. They provide a sleeping area alongside a trailer for storage. Camper trailers are popular among off-road and adventure travelers since they are compact and easy to tow.
Pop-Top Caravans
These have a roof that can be raised or expanded for additional height and ventilation. When the roof is lowered, it becomes more aerodynamic and easier to tow. This feature also makes it simpler to store the caravan. Pop-top caravans strike a balance between comfort and compactness.
Motorhomes
Also referred to as motorcaravans, these are self-propelled vehicles that incorporate living spaces and caravan amenities. They come in different classes, including Class A, Class B, and Class C, varying in size and internal layout. Motorhomes offer convenience and comfort.
Fifth Wheel Caravans
These are towed by a hitch mounted on the bed of a pickup truck. They provide spacious and luxurious interiors with separate living areas, kitchens, and bathrooms. Fifth wheels are ideal for extended travels or as mobile residences because they offer stability when towing.
Teardrop Caravans
These are small, compact caravans with a distinctive teardrop shape. They have a sleeping area and a kitchen, with a rear galley kitchen. Their lightweight construction makes them easy to tow and maneuver. Teardrop caravans are popular among minimalists who prefer simple camping accommodations.

Q1: What are the common materials used in the construction of caravans?
A1: Caravans are mostly constructed with materials like aluminum, fiberglass, and steel, plywood, and metal sheets. These materials are durable, lightweight, and able to withstand the various weather conditions.
Q2: Are custom caravans more expensive than standard models?
A2: Custom caravans come at an additional cost because they are built as per the specific requirements of an individual buyer. The cost will depend on the level of customization and the materials used.
Q3: How do manufacturers ensure the waterproofness of a caravan?
A3: Waterproofing a caravan involves the use of sealants and treatment that need regular inspection to avoid any form of leakage. The sealants are applied on the roof, windows, doors, and joints to prevent water ingress.
Q4: How do caravan manufacturers ensure energy efficiency?
A4: Energy efficiency in caravans is achieved through proper insulation, energy-efficient appliances, and the use of solar panels. Good insulation minimizes energy consumption by maintaining comfortable interior temperatures.
